
Former Union minister V.C. Shukla today quit the NCP’s Chhattisgarh’s unit party and formed his own regional outfit.
‘‘We have left NCP and I have been made the president of the newly-formed outfit,’’ Shukla said while christening his group as Rashtriya Jantantrik Dal.
Pointing out that he would maintain a ‘‘cordial relationship’’ with all NCP leaders while remaining ‘‘neutral’’ vis-a-vis differences between Sharad Pawar and P.A. Sangma, Shukla said: ‘‘We will fight the elections under NDA manifesto.’’
Replying to a question, he said: ‘‘If the Congress wants the assistance of Priyanka and Rahul Gandhi to do well in the elections then only God can save them.’’
He also said his party will work in Vidarbha region of Maharashtra and Mahakoshal region of Madhya Pradesh.
